Examine the table, which represents a linear function.
What is the rate of change of the function?
Input (x) Output (y)
-5 18
−3 23
−1 28
1 33

Answer:

  2.5

Step-by-step explanation:

The rate of change can be found from the slope formula.

  m = (y2 -y1)/(x2 -x1)

Using the first two lines of the table, we find ...

  m = (23 -18)/(-3 -(-5)) = 5/2

The rate of change of the function is 5/2 = 2.5.
